We have switched our math curriculum over from Singapore to Math U See. It's more complete with in-depth teachings and comes with a DVD for the kids to use in addition to the teacher's guide for me. It also includes counting blocks which will help Allie a lot since she seems to need a tangible math. While one student works on their math- watching the DVD and working through their worksheets- I work with the other kid in reading/spelling. So far it has been working much better to rotate them.
